ASTM International’s Additive Manufacturing Center of Excellence (AM CoE) announced awardees of its Call for Projects (CFP) in support of its Research to Standards initiative to further accelerate standards development for additive manufacturing (AM). For the first time, the CFP allowed non-AM CoE partners to propose and receive support for projects focused on closing AM standardization gaps. In light of COVID-19 (coronavirus) and ongoing safety concerns for members and staff, ASTM International announced today that all previously scheduled in-person May and June standards development meetings (including D02 and independent meetings) have been transitioned to all virtual. Presentations are invited for the 2021 ASTM International Conference on Additive Manufacturing (ICAM 2021), hosted by the ASTM International Additive Manufacturing Center of Excellence (AM CoE) and supported by more than a dozen ASTM technical committees. This conference will be held November 1-5, 2021. ASTM International’s snow and water sports committee ( F27 ) is developing a standard that will be used to determine how resistant a water ski is to permanent bending. Last week, hundreds of industry leaders and experts from around the world attended the International Conference on Additive Manufacturing (ICAM 2020). Held virtually Nov. 16–20, the conference was sponsored by the ASTM International Additive Manufacturing Center of Excellence (AM CoE) and a dozen of ASTM technical committees. A new ASTM International standard test method will support the measurement of nanoparticle-based products used in a wide range of applications from cancer therapy to antibacterial coatings in textiles. ASTM’s nanotechnology committee ( E56 ) developed the new standard, which was recently published as E3247 .
